What is Melatonin?

Melatonin is a naturally occurring hormone produced primarily by the pineal gland in the brain. It plays a key role in regulating circadian rhythms, signaling to the body when it is time to sleep and wake up. Melatonin levels rise in the evening, peak during the night, and decrease in the morning, helping maintain a consistent sleep-wake schedule. This hormone is not only important for adults but also for infants, who are in the process of developing their own circadian rhythms. The presence of melatonin in breastmilk could potentially support this developmental process.

Nighttime Breastmilk and Melatonin

Research has shown that the composition of breastmilk changes throughout the day in response to maternal circadian rhythms. Nighttime breastmilk differs from daytime milk in several ways, including higher concentrations of certain hormones and nutrients that can influence infant sleep and growth. One of the most notable differences is the presence of melatonin, which is typically absent or present at much lower levels in daytime breastmilk.

Scientific Evidence

Several studies have confirmed that melatonin is naturally present in breastmilk and its levels fluctuate based on the time of day. At night, melatonin concentration is significantly higher, which aligns with the mother’s own melatonin cycle. This nocturnal breastmilk provides infants with a signal that it is nighttime, which may promote longer and more restful sleep. The amount of melatonin in breastmilk is small compared to adult doses, but it is sufficient to influence infants’ developing circadian rhythms.

Factors Affecting Melatonin Levels in Breastmilk

While nighttime breastmilk naturally contains melatonin, several factors can influence its concentration. Maternal sleep patterns, exposure to light, diet, and lifestyle can all affect melatonin production and subsequently its presence in breastmilk.

Maternal Sleep and Circadian Rhythm

Mothers who maintain a consistent sleep schedule and experience healthy circadian rhythms are likely to produce breastmilk with more predictable melatonin patterns. Disrupted sleep or irregular schedules may affect melatonin levels, potentially influencing the nighttime cues received by the infant.

Exposure to Light

Light exposure, particularly blue light from screens, can suppress melatonin production. Mothers who use electronic devices extensively at night may experience lower nighttime melatonin levels, which could slightly reduce the melatonin content in breastmilk.

Diet and Lifestyle

Certain foods, supplements, and lifestyle choices may influence melatonin production. A balanced diet and practices that support healthy sleep can enhance natural melatonin levels, indirectly benefiting nighttime breastmilk quality.

Practical Tips for Maximizing Nighttime Breastmilk Benefits

Parents seeking to support their infant’s sleep using the natural properties of nighttime breastmilk can adopt strategies to enhance its benefits.

Breastfeed During Nighttime Hours

Feeding your baby during the evening or nighttime ensures that they receive milk with higher melatonin content. This natural signal can help reinforce a regular sleep-wake pattern and support longer periods of rest.

Create a Sleep-Friendly Environment

Dim lighting, minimal noise, and a calm atmosphere during nighttime feedings can amplify the melatonin effect. Reducing exposure to bright or blue light helps maintain the infant’s natural response to nighttime cues.

Maintain Healthy Maternal Sleep

Prioritizing your own rest can help regulate melatonin production, ensuring that nighttime breastmilk contains optimal levels of the hormone. Consistent sleep routines and minimizing late-night screen exposure are beneficial practices.
